A NEW DESIGN FOR TEACHING FOREIGN LANGUAGES USING DRAMATIC MOTION PICTURES AND PROGRAMMED LEARNING MATERIALS

Abstract

A proposed project aimed at improving language instruction methods and augmenting the capabilities of schools for teaching foreign languages effectively, even where a shortage of skilled language teachers exists, is described. Problems encountered in national foreign-language area needs are listed: (1) the teacher shortage; (2) instruction sequence and neglect of listening comprehension; (3) student motivation in foreign language teaching; and (4) the development and implementation of technological innovations. A blueprint for the development of new methods and materials and for the conduct of research to obtain answers to important foreign-language learning questions is suggested. (Author)
